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97569161171 1117 61500940 06061 488
59393595 120683 39736
59393595 120683 39736
29269 7832 9052 829440001 34803
All about undefined
Interested in learning more?
59393595 120683 39736
29269 7832 9052 829440001 34803
See more
788928123 557945674 08768562
8386774 608331186 92412
See more
2828157859 21
8753263 727328633 77
See more